John Thomas Dorman transitioned from this realm at the age 77 on August 7th, 2022 in Chicago, Illinois. He was born in Vivian, West Virginia on April 23, 1945 to parents Doyal Dorman Sr. and mother, LucyMae Pinkard.
John attended Kimball High School where he earned his diploma. He later moved to Chicago, Illinois in 1964 to further his passion. John was truly a jack of all trades. He not only played multiple instruments, but was able to read, write and teach music. He created masterpieces using paint, charcoal, clay as well as calligraphy.
John was known to be exceptionally charming and charismatic. His talents eventually led him to performing in the Chicago downtown area, and all the way to England where he performed with a band for several years.
